Overview

Passengers board the yacht at Reykjavík’s Old Harbour to begin a three-hour whale watching cruise along the city’s coastline and through Faxaflói Bay. The boat sails past small islands, including Engey, Lundey (Puffin Island), and Viðey, providing views of the Reykjavik coast and the bay. The tour aims to spot marine wildlife such as minke whales, humpback whales, dolphins, porpoises, and occasionally orcas (killer whales). The crew consists of professional guides skilled at locating whales and marine animals. On board, guests can use spacious observation decks and restrooms, stay warm with provided blankets, and access WiFi. Drinks and snacks are available for purchase. The yacht passes notable landmarks such as the Harpa Concert Hall, known for its colored glass facade inspired by Iceland’s basalt formations. Weather conditions affect the tour schedule and cancellations may occur. If no whales are sighted, the operator offers a free return trip within three years, subject to availability.

2

Harpa Concert Hall and Conference Centre

Harpa is a concert hall and conference centre in Reykjavík, opened on May 4, 2011. It features a distinctive colored glass facade influenced by Iceland’s basalt landscape.

3

Faxaflói Bay

Faxaflói Bay lies on Iceland’s southern shore. From Reykjavík, views include the Akranes peninsula to the northeast and the distant Snæfellsjökull volcano about 120 km away. The bay has few islands, mostly close to shore, unlike the bay north of it, Breiðafjörður, which contains the largest number of islands in Iceland.
